About Zork
Zork is a single player action game with a fantasy theme. It was developed by Infocom and was released on June 1, 1977. It received neutral reviews from players.
Zork is one of the earliest interactive fiction computer games, with roots drawn from the original genre game, Colossal Cave Adventure. The first version of Zork was written in 1977–1979 using the MDL programming language on a DEC PDP-10 computer.
